USS Gerald R. Ford Aircraft Carrier (CVN-78) is the lead ship of the U.S. Navy's newest class of nuclear-powered aircraft carriers. Named after the 38th President of the United States, the ship was built by Newport News Shipbuilding and commissioned in July 2017. It represents the first major carrier design update in over 40 years. The Ford-class introduces advanced technologies, including the Electromagnetic Aircraft Launch System (EMALS), Advanced Arresting Gear (AAG), and a redesigned island. These innovations increase sortie rates, reduce crew requirements, and improve efficiency. The ship also features improved radar, weapons elevators, and power systems for future upgrades. As the most advanced carrier in the world, USS Gerald R. Ford Aircraft Carrier (CVN-78) is central to the Navy's future force projection. It began its first full deployment in 2023, marking a new era in American naval aviation and global maritime operations.
